ONE Gas, formerly known as ONEOK, is a natural gas distribution company headquartered in Tulsa, Oklahoma. It operates in Oklahoma, Kansas, and Texas and serves approximately 2.2 million customers through its regulated utility subsidiaries.


The company's primary business is the distribution of natural gas to residential, commercial, and industrial customers. It also owns and operates a network of natural gas storage facilities and provides energy-related services such as engineering, consulting, and construction. ONE Gas is committed to providing safe, reliable, and affordable natural gas service to its customers and is actively involved in initiatives to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and promote sustainable energy practices.

ONE Gas Common Stock Risk Assessment

ONE Gas, Inc. (ONE) is a publicly traded company that operates a natural gas distribution and storage business. The company's st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ange and is a component of the S&P 500 index. ONE's primary risk factors include regulatory changes, economic conditions, and competition. Regulatory changes could impact the company's rates and operations. Economic conditions could affect demand for natural gas and the company's ability to generate revenue. Competition could reduce the company's market share and profitability.


ONE's regulatory risk is primarily related to the regulation of its natural gas distribution and storage operations. The company is subject to regulation by the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C) and various state public utility commissions. These regulatory bodies have the authority to set rates, approve new projects, and enforce environmental regulations. Changes in regulatory policies could have a significant impact on ONE's financial performance.


ONE's economic risk is primarily related to the demand for natural gas. The demand for natural gas is influenced by weather conditions, economic activity, and the availability of alternative energy sources. Severe weather conditions can increase demand for natural gas for heating and cooling. Economic downturns can reduce demand for natural gas for industrial and commercial purposes. The availability of alternative energy sources, such as renewable energy and coal, can also reduce demand for natural gas.


ONE's competition risk is primarily related to the presence of other natural gas distributors and the availability of alternative energy sources. ONE competes with other natural gas distributors for market share and customers. The company also competes with alternative energy sources, such as renewable energy and coal. Increased competition could reduce ONE's market share and profitability.
